About this work

This painting depicts a dramatic scene of a man on horseback, standing atop a large pedestal. The man is dressed in a suit and tie, holding the reins of the horse in his left hand. He appears to be looking out over a cityscape, with several people gathered at the base of the pedestal. The cityscape is depicted in a dark, moody tone, with tall buildings and smokestacks visible in the background. The overall atmosphere of the painting is one of grandeur and drama, with the man on horseback serving as a symbol of power and authority.
